Setting up a grade R class

Today I'm going through the Department of Education's National Curriculum Documents and I thought I'd share some of the things that I come across with you. All of us need to comply with these regulations- as a public school, as a private school or even as a home school.
One of the first thing we need to look at are the allocated teaching times. The time that they require for each learning area are the following:
Home Language 10 hours per week
Mathematics 6 hours
Life skills 5 hours

That gives you a total of 23 hours per week.

The challenge for every teacher is how to make this time interesting and beneficial for the learner.

The way I set up my class timetable is as follows:
8:30-10:00 Literacy (home language)
10:30-11:45 Mathematics
12:30-13:30 Life skills
15:00-15:30 Literacy (story time)
